Hostel in a good location, not far from Plymouth, facilities are basic really, but the kitchen is reasonably well equipped. One of those hostels though with lots of long term guests around. Overall though, a reasonable hostel to stay short term.

Nice small hostel with good facilities, but the self-catering kitchens were so dirty you wouldn't want to touch anything. Room was great value for money, bathrooms could have done with more cleaning as well. But overall just fine for what you pay! We had a nice stay.
